The Luminous Joan has two kilts/skirts.
One is a very nice wool, knee-length kilt skirt in Dress Blue Stewart. Honest truth is that she essentially never wears it. I think it's seen the light of day twice: once about 6 years ago to visit my 90 year old stepmother in her care home and once for a Scottish dressy event...I forget which, exactly. Basically, she hates the thing and tells me that she won't wear it because it makes her look like a Librarian.
Personally, I don't see the problem with looking like a Librarian, but that's her quote, not mine.
One of her ancestors, definitely Scottish was surnamed Smart, which is a sept of Clan MacKenzie. I got her a sportkilt in the MacKenzie tartan, which she has now worn twice. She likes it because it's not too hot. It's long enough that the scars from two hip surgeries are covered up but yet it's not so long as to be matronly..... or "Librarianly", I suppose. The Sportkilt is of course "in theory" made for a man, but they're not "fitted" in any way and she wears it just fine.
